At Kidz Korner, we try and keep all the children happy and busy, thus avoiding many potential discipline problems. However, if problems arise, we will first attempt to simply redirect the child to a more appropriate activity. In rare cases, time out may be used, but always within the visible space of the room and for never more than one minute per year of age. Upon pickup, parents will receive all information regarding any discipline that was necessary. Corporal punishment is NEVER allowed at Kidz Korner.

In the Event of an Emergency:
In the unlikely event of an emergency, the following procedures will be followed:
Fire: The staff will evacuate the building according to a prearranged, posted and practiced plan. The children will be kept together until parents/guardians can be contacted to pick them up.
Snow/Blizzard: Upon conditions worsening, parents will be called to pick up children. The senior supervisor on site will monitor weather reports closely and close the center early if necessary so that the staff and children can safely make their way home.
Lock Down: In the event of a township police required lock down, parents/guardians will be notified by phone and kept appraised of the situation to the best of our abilities. We will maintain enough food/snacks to keep children fed during emergency situations.
Abandoned child: If a child is left at the center for more than 1 hour past closing time and we are unable to reach an emergency contact, DYFS will be notified.
Accident/Injury: All of our staff are trained in first aid and CPR, and we maintain a well-stocked first aid kit. In the event of a minor accident, the staff will provide first aid, and write a report to be kept on file and a copy given to parents. If further assistance is required, the staff will call 911 and the parents will be notified immediately.
Medications: Please arrange medication schedules to give your child any medicines before or after their stay at Kidz Korner. The staff at Kidz Korner will not administer any medication except for life saving medications (i.e. epi-pen or inhaler that is provided).

Reporting of Child Abuse or Neglect: New Jersey State law requires that any staff member who has reasonable cause to know or suspect that a child has been subjected to abuse or neglect, or who has observed the child being subjected to circumstances or conditions which could result in abuse or neglect, shall immediately report to the county department of human services or local law enforcement agency in the community or county where the center is located.
